From March 31 to May 5, 2023, in an online format in the amount of 72 hours, Doctor of Law Valery Lisitsa (Novosibirsk State University, Novosibirsk; Institute of State and Law of the Russian Academy of Sciences, Moscow, Russia) conducted classes on the methodology of scientific research in the field of jurisprudence, within which he revealed the specifics of the organization of scientific work, requirements for master's and doctoral dissertations, structure and presentation of a scientific legal text. Special attention was paid to the problem of suitability and scientific novelty of the dissertation research. Within the framework of the research seminar, the topics, structure and main provisions of the undergraduates and doctoral students submitted for defense were discussed. Doctoral and undergraduates showed an increased interest in discussing the development of public speaking skills. Furthermore, lectures were given on topical issues of business and international private law. The lecturer highlighted theoretical approaches to understanding the essence, basic concepts and categories, institutions, legal statuses, legal relations in business and private international law, taking into account the development of modern economic relations.
